Responsibilities

As an Electronics Quality Engineer, you will be involved in the full product lifecycle, from sales and development through to series production and end-of-life. You act as a key point of contact for quality, ensuring that customer requirements are met, processes are continuously improved, and long-term reliability is secured.

 

In this role, you:

·       Lead quality discussions with both internal teams and customers.

·       Translate customer requirements into clear organizational actions.

·       Ensure that new products (NPI) meet quality standards from the design phase through production.

·       Drive continuous improvement and inspire teams to refine ways of working.

·       Take ownership of identifying and addressing key quality challenges.

·       Support product and process design decisions with a focus on reliability.

·       Conduct and lead root cause analyses and improvement programs.

·       Contribute to supplier quality management activities.

Your critical thinking skills and collaborative approach make you a trusted partner in problem-solving and process optimization.

What do you bring?

·       Bachelor’s or Master’s degree in Electrical, Mechanical, Industrial Engineering, Applied Physics, or related technical discipline.

·       At least 6 years of experience as a Quality Engineer, preferably with experience in an environment with PCBA’s and digital analysis.

·       Strong knowledge of problem-solving and quality tools (8D, 5 Whys, Ishikawa, FMEA, JIRA, Power BI).

·       Experience in a manufacturing environment.

·       Background in electronics is a strong plus.
